Hendersonvllle, Tenn. DURHAM Wednesday evening, June 3, 1964, at a local hospital. William Robert Durham, age 67 years. Survived by wife, Mrs. Elma Hale Durham, Hendersonvllle; sons, Carl Durham. Madison, Earl Durham, Madison. James Durham. Nashville. Donald Durham, Doneison; daughters, Mrs. Kenneth Plujilee. Lakeland. Fla., Mrs. Charles Dorris. Nashville. Mrs. R. V. Scott, Tunica. Miss., Mrs. Bruce Johnson. Nashville; and 22 grandchildren; Brothers, Harry Durham, Hendersonvllle, John D. Durham Orlinda; sisters, Mrs. Jesse Angela, Greenbrier, Mrs. Dewey Steele. Franklin, Ky., Mrs. Dewev Doss, Mrs. Carsie Mundy, Nashville. Remains are at the Cole and Garrett Funeral Home, Hendersonvllle, Services will be conducted Friday afternoon, June 5, at 3:00 O'clock, at the First Baptist Church, Hendersonvllle, bv Rev. Courtney Wilson, Honorary Pallbearers Employees of the Power Department of E, 1. Dupont Co.. Deacons and Members of the Men's Bible Class of the First Baptist Church of Hendersonvllle. Members of Beech Lodge. No. 240 FI.AM, Active pallbearers W. A. Fennell, Dennis Carter, Noble Caudlll, J. H. Pate. S. S. Warren, D. E. Arrlngton, A. A. Plumlee, Frank Bush, Vlroll Hunter. Interment Forrest Lawn Cemetery. Cole and Garrett Funeral Directors, Hendersonville
